The other evening, we had a knock at the door, it was our (elderly) neighbours daughter.
Her mother was stuck in the bath, and they needed a hand to get her out!!!!
Well, Jeremy was no use, cos of his stuffed neck, so I bowled on over, not sure of what to expect at all.
Now the old lady next door (she must be in her 80's) has dementia, so you never really know what you are gonna get when you see her, and Tuesday night was no exception.
I got in the bathroom, there she was, fully clothed, stuck on her butt in the bath.
Her husband (also in his 80's) walks with a limp, and can hardly keep himself upright at times, so he was no use.
So it was up to me and her daughter (who must be in her 60's) to haul her out of the empty bath.
We got her out no problems, and she was a little embarrassed, but I brushed it off, and told her not to give it a second thought, and off I went home again.
Well...... about 5 minutes later there was a knock at the door..... it was Alma, the wife, trying to give me a bottle of whisky for helping her out of the bath!!!
I FINALLY convinced her that I didn't want to take her whisky, and she went off home again.
2 minutes later there was another knock at the door.
It was Alma again.
This time she was trying to give me her bloody chest freezer!!!!!!!!
I sent her on her way - telling her that I didn't want her freezer and besides, I had no where to put it!
I thought all was well, when she suddenly appeared again, this time with a bottle of wine for me!
Her husband was two steps behind her, telling me to take it cos if I didn't, she would never let up! hehehehe....
That was all good, I didn't hear from them again.......
Until........
Last night when I arrived home after work, there was Ray waiting for me.
He was so worried, because Alma had just told him that she was giving me their freezer!!!!
Hahahahahahahaha........
I just laughed and told him that I had no intention of taking their freezer!
I think he was bloody relieved at that!!!
It must be so damn hard to live with someone with Dementia.
I can't begin to imagine the pain that it must cause at times....
So sad.....
